What's the trick to preventing stacked plastic buckets from sticking together?
Per
:
Doesn't have to be "a few inches" just enough to prevent the seal from forming.
A little experimentation will determine exactly what thickness you need.
My first try was with a hunk of blue foam about 1" x 2" and it only
worked if it was more-or-less in the center. Way off to one side, and
the buckets mated.
Release 1.1 will be longer pieces - long enough so that they cannot wind
up too far off center.... like 8 or 10 inches.....
I'm also starting to think that scrap wood will be better because it
won't blow away after it's dumped out of a bucket.
Now that I'm thinking about it.....
If I were determined to spend some money, 1.5" or 1" dowl, cut
accordingly.
